RUSTON, La. – The No. 9 Louisiana Tech women's bowling team is set to compete in the Tulane-hosted Colonial Lanes Classic in Harahan, La., from Oct. 22-24.
Â
TOURNAMENT DETAILS
Tournament: Colonial Lanes Classic
Host: Tulane
Date: Oct. 22-24
Location: Harahan, La.
Format:
    Friday: Five Baker games
   Â
Saturday: Five traditional games
   Â
Sunday: Three best 4-of-7 Baker matches
Teams: No. 16 Tulane, Alabama State, Florida A&M, Grambling State, Jackson State, No. 9 Louisiana Tech, No. 18 Lincoln Memorial, No. 5 North Carolina A&T, No. 22 Prairie View A&M, No. 6 Sam Houston, No. 10 Stephen F. Austin, Texas Southern, No. 20 Maryland Eastern Shore and No. 4 Vanderbilt.

ABOUT LOUISIANA TECH
Tech opened the 2021-22 season by competing at two SWIBC events earlier this month. LA Tech won the second event after registering 6,779 total pins. JuniorÂ
Danielle Jedlicki was named the tournament MVP after recording the first perfect game in program history to finish the event with an individual pinfall of 1,505.
Â
Louisiana Tech is coming off of a historic season as the team earned its highest ranking in program history as the Lady Techsters were ranked fifth in the National Tenpin Coaches Association February Poll. Tech made its first national championship appearances at both the 2021 National Collegiate Women's Bowling Championship and the Intercollegiate Team Championship (ITC). At the NCAA Tournament, the Lady Techsters registered the first perfect Baker game in program history after bowling a 300.
LA Tech competed in 14 events and placed in the top-five at nine tournaments during the 2020-21 season. Tech finished second at four tournaments, including the Southland Conference Championships. Then-seniorÂ
Kaitlyn Eder and then-sophomoreÂ
Allie Leiendecker were named to the 2021 All-Southland Bowling League Third Team. Leiendecker was also named a NTCA All-American honorable mention.
Â
Head coach
Matt Nantais enters his sixth year at the helm of the Louisiana Tech bowling team after leading the Lady Techsters to the five most successful seasons in program history.
